Grandpa would sail on June 4, so this postmark records the day the letter was processed.

When Grandpa wrote this letter on June 1, three days before the departure, he sensed his correspondence would change. There would be fewer letters, and his would be censored. But he also knew, and reminded Grandma, that her letters were the best thing he had, and to keep them coming. Here’s the complete letter, the last one he wrote from the U.S.
